Easy Floral Decoupage Idea for Faux Pumpkin Display

 Hi everyone! I'm excited to share a simple and easy floral pumpkin design you can create quickly. Today, we will make a faux floral pumpkin display using decoupage and a few additional designs. I'm reusing a foam pumpkin that I bought at Dollar Tree. If you’re ready, let’s begin creating an easy floral decoupage faux pumpkin display! Quick video tutorial **Materials needed:** - Acrylic paint - Paintbrush - Floral napkin - Faux pearls - Faux flowers - Craft knife - Scissors - Mod Podge Carefully remove the top of your pumpkin. I used my craft knife to go around the top section, creating a hole at the top. Using a paintbrush, apply acrylic paint to the pumpkin. I chose to paint mine black. Next, use scissors to cut out a few flowers from your napkin. Make sure to remove the second layer of the napkin before cutting out the designs.   Once you have your floral designs cut out, use a paintbrush to apply Mod Podge to the pumpkin. DIY Floral Wooden Jack‑O’‑Lanterns (Easy Fall Decor)

I’ve been having so much fun creating fall projects this year. These floral wooden jack‑o’‑lanterns  started as simple wooden pumpkins, but with a few pretty transfers and some soft paint colors, they turned into the sweetest little fall accents. I love how the florals give them a cozy, cottage‑style feel while still keeping that classic jack‑o’‑lantern charm. They’re quick to make, easy to customize, and such a cute way to add a warm autumn touch to your home. Watch the video tutorial Materials Wooden pumpkin cutouts Floral transfers Acrylic paint (your chosen colors) Gold acrylic paint Green acrylic paint Mini dowels Hot glue gun + glue sticks Small wooden stands Brown acrylic paint Paintbrushes   Add the floral transfers I started by placing my floral transfers onto each wooden pumpkin, just arranging them until they felt right.
